for the first one:
sin^2 Ø + cos^2 Ø = 1
divide each term by cos^2 Ø
sin^2 Ø/cos^2 Ø + cos^2 Ø/cos^2 Ø = 1/cos^2 Ø
tan^2 Ø + 1 = sec^2 Ø, (since 1/cosx = secx)
do the 2nd by dividing each term by sin^2 Ø
